15% off eLearning, up to 20% off virtual courses - use code: NSWOCT25USA

c5d81b05-00c9-4dd6-82fc-953434ad93ee

Oracle SQL

Select your learning method

Learn essential skills
Course overview

Our Oracle SQL course provides you with a clear, practical pathway to work confidently with databases. You’ll explore how to query and organise information, create structured code, and manage data effectively, giving you the skills to support better decision-making and improve the efficiency of business operations. 

Strengthen your Oracle SQL expertise to improve database performance

Learn the core techniques needed to work confidently with Oracle SQL in real-world settings. You’ll progress from writing SELECT statements and joins to applying subqueries, set operators and functions. The course also explores creating and managing tables, views and indexes, equipping you to improve reporting accuracy and optimise database performance. 

Learning objectives
  • Write SQL statements to query and manipulate data 
  • Combine datasets using different join techniques 
  • Apply functions for calculations and data formatting 
  • Create and manage tables, views and database objects 
  • Use subqueries and inline views for complex queries 
  • Merge results effectively with set operations 
  • Control sequences, indexes and synonyms for efficiency 

What you’ll learn

This three-day Oracle SQL course provides a solid grounding in database programming. You’ll learn how to write queries, combine data with joins, and apply functions for analysis. The course also covers subqueries, transactions and optimisation techniques, giving you the skills to manage and structure Oracle databases effectively. 

Working with SQL parameters

Learn how SQL parameters make your scripts more dynamic and reusable. You’ll see how to accept user input, define and undefine variables, and incorporate substitution parameters. These skills help you design SQL statements that adapt to different situations, making your queries more versatile and efficient. 

Advanced subqueries

Move beyond the basics by mastering advanced subquery techniques. You’ll explore inline views, correlated subqueries and multi-column queries, as well as strategies for filtering with ANY, ALL and SOME. These approaches enable you to break down complex logic, improve readability, and build queries that deliver highly targeted results. 

Transaction control

Understand how to manage data changes safely and effectively. You’ll learn when to commit updates permanently, how to roll back changes if something goes wrong, and how to use savepoints to manage work in stages. These transaction techniques give you complete control over data reliability in Oracle SQL. 

Indexes, views and performance

Discover how to optimise database performance with the right structures. You’ll learn how to create and manage indexes, develop views that simplify complex queries, and maintain them effectively. These features not only improve query speed but also help you organise and present data more clearly across Oracle environments. 

What’s included
  • Three-days of instructor-led training in a live virtual classroom  
  • Interactive hands-on live labs  
  • All relevant course materials 

Key facts

Ideal for

Perfect for those working with Oracle databases, from beginners to professionals wanting to refresh SQL skills and gain confidence in querying and managing data. 

Prerequisites

No SQL experience required, though familiarity with databases or IT concepts is helpful. The course introduces everything needed to develop a strong Oracle SQL foundation. 

Learning experience

Our experienced trainers and interactive labs create a focused, practical environment – so you can put theory into practice from day one. 

FAQs

The Oracle SQL course takes you from the fundamentals through to working with tables, joins, subqueries and database objects. With live labs, you’ll build practical skills that can be applied directly to workplace scenarios, giving you the confidence to manage and query Oracle databases effectively. 

What is Oracle SQL?

Oracle SQL is the standard language for working with Oracle databases. It allows you to query data, update records, and manage how information is stored and accessed. This course focuses on practical applications, helping you write efficient SQL statements that support reporting, analysis and day-to-day database management. 

Will I learn to use both SQL*Plus and SQL Developer?

Yes. The course introduces both SQL*Plus and SQL Developer, giving you confidence in using each tool. You’ll learn how to connect to databases, run scripts, navigate schema objects, and take advantage of features such as query history and formatting, ensuring you’re prepared for workplace requirements. 

Do we learn how to create and manage user-defined objects?

Yes. You’ll explore how to create and manage views, indexes and sequences, as well as how synonyms make database objects easier to access. These features help you tailor the behaviour of an Oracle database, giving you flexibility and efficiency in your SQL development. 

Will this course help with Oracle certification exams?

Yes. The Oracle SQL course is excellent preparation for the Oracle Database SQL Fundamentals exam (1Z0-071). While certification requires additional study and practice, the course covers the core skills and knowledge areas you’ll need to approach the exam with greater confidence and understanding. 

Why study with ILX
500,000+ learners

Join the half a million learners developing their skills with our training 

5,000+ businesses

A trusted partner to thousands of organisations worldwide 

96% customer satisfaction

Our passionate team goes above and beyond to support customer needs 

We're here to help
Speak to our learning experts

Not sure which course or study option is right for you? Get in touch with our team of advisors for personalised guidance and support throughout your learning journey.

Business transformation
Looking to develop your business or team?

Need to upskill your team? Our bespoke development solutions are designed to enhance team performance, retain talent, and drive organisational excellence. One of our development consultants would love to chat.

Quote request

Please complete the form to ensure your quote is accurate and we will contact you soon.

By submitting this form, you agree to ILX processing your data in line with our Privacy Policy. You can unsubscribe at any time by clicking the link in our emails or contacting us directly.

Page {{ step }} of 2

Back Next